Medical Treatment
The majority of accident lawsuits involve medical treatment. The injured victims require medical documents and bills to prove their injuries, the damage the accident caused them, and the extent of pain they have suffered.
Many people don’t seek medical care after a car crash for a variety of reasons. Perhaps they are feeling fine at the time or aren’t sure they have an injury. Perhaps they’re in a hurry to get home and want to rest. Whatever the reason for why they do not seek medical attention, this could impact their claim for compensation.
First doctors are the only person to confirm whether an injury was caused by an accident. They can also determine the cause of an injury and create an treatment plan. This is why it’s important to consult a doctor right after a car accident. It is also important to follow-up with any specialists or doctors that are recommended, take any prescribed medications, and attend all scheduled follow-up appointments.
Your medical records will be reviewed by insurance companies to determine the severity of your injuries. They may also try to use them against you by asserting that the injury you claim to have is actually a pre-existing problem or the injury was caused by something other than the accident. This can be avoided if you see an experienced doctor who is aware of what to look for and will provide you with the proper evidence.
Moreover, a doctor can determine the length of time the treatment will last and when you’ll reach maximum medical improvement (MMI). MMI is the term used to describe a point in your recovery when you are likely to not recover further. This allows your lawyer to determine the amount of compensation you’re entitled to for medical expenses, lost wages and property damage. This can be used as leverage to increase the amount of the insurance settlement offer. Accurate and complete medical records can also help you avoid missing deadlines for payment, which could have severe financial consequences.

Lost Wages
You may be entitled to compensation for loss of earnings resulting from your injuries from an accident. This kind of compensation can help you return to the financial position you’d be in if not been able to work as you recovered. When pursuing this type of compensation, you need to be prepared to present documents to support your claim. These documents could include paystubs and tax documents.
It is important to understand that lost wages are considered part of a general category of damages called “economic damages.” Economic damages are paid to compensate you for the costs directly related to your accident Compensation Claim and injury. Therefore the loss of income is just one element of your total compensation package, which also includes other costs such as medical treatment, property damage as well as pain and suffering.
You’ll need proof to prove the loss of wages. This includes the time you missed at work due to the accident as well as the injuries you suffered. This could include a letter that contains relevant information, including dates you were unable to work as well as your current salary and the number of hours you work per week. You can also attach documents such as receipts, profit and loss statements bank statements, or other financial information that can support your claim.
Your attorney can review the documents and information that you submit to the insurance companies to make sure all information is correct and complete prior to filing an application for compensation for lost wages. This is essential because if you are not careful, any errors in these documents can result in a denial of the amount of your damages.

Pain and Suffering
Pain and suffering is a kind of non-monetary damage that an injured victim can seek compensation for. It includes any physical and emotional pain or suffering that an accident victim suffers due to their injuries. The type of damage that this kind of person suffers is more difficult to quantify than medical bills or lost wages. It requires more evidence, like witnesses’ testimony as well as the victim’s own statements.
Pain is the most obvious part of suffering and pain damages. However, it could also include other things. It could include any discomfort in your body due to an injury for instance, bruises or abrasions. It also encompasses your emotions like anxiety or fear, as well as depression. It can also be the loss of income like the money you lose because you aren’t able to perform the things you loved prior to your accident.
There are a variety of methods for calculating pain and suffering and the method employed will be based on your particular circumstances. Certain insurance companies employ the multiplier method. The actual damages you suffer are tallied and then multiplied with a figure dependent on the severity of your injury to estimate your suffering and Accident Compensation Claim pain. A jury or judge will then make a final decision on the worth of your pain and suffering.
